Transaction 21d5dbd27ef3beaaf4be3055ea09e881bc37cbb2401b804646032810652a3466
1 Input
1 Output
-
21d5dbd27ef3beaaf4be3055ea09e881bc37cbb2401b804646032810652a3466:0
- value
- 382745
- script pubkey
- OP_0 OP_PUSHBYTES_20 589f00fca681b6c90d1f6e70b4b01bf33cb93adc
- address
- bc1qtz0spl9xsxmvjrgldectfvqm7v7tjwkumdwvya